[QUOTE="jggtn, post: 1206925, member: 23890"] [b]Photobucket Drops (free) 3rd Party Hosting Support[/b] [B]Wonder why your Photobucket images won't post to the forums?[/B] Some time earlier this year, Photobucket stopped supporting free "3rd Party Hosted" images. 3rd Party Hosting is what the Ford Raptor Forum does when it allows you to link your Photobucket images to forum posts and replies. This explains why there are so many dead links to Photobucket hosted images in the forums here. It's really gotten very bad with all free Photobucket account images linking to an image that reads: "[COLOR="Red"][B][U]PLEASE UPDATE YOUR ACCOUNT TO ENABLE 3RD PARTY HOSTING[/U][/B][/COLOR]": [ATTACH=full]275630[/ATTACH] Enter [URL="http://www.photobucket.com/P500/"]www.photobucket.com/P500[/URL] into your favorite browser and link to a Photobucket subscription page asking you to pay $400 for Photobucket's "PLUS 500" subscription plan. It's the only plan allowing Photobucket account holders to post images to sites like FordRaptorForum.com. It's infuriating. The work around is to post links from alternative image hosting sites, such as: [URL="http://www.screencast.com"]Screencast[/URL] [URL="https://www.flickr.com/"]Flickr[/URL] [URL="https://www.tumblr.com/"]Tumblr[/URL] [URL="https://plus.google.com/explore"]Google+[/URL] [URL="https://www.blogger.com/about/?r=1-null_user"]Blogspot[/URL] [URL="https://www.snapfish.com/photo-gift/home"]Snapfish[/URL] [URL="https://www.shutterfly.com/photos/?esch=1"]Shutterfly[/URL] [URL="https://www.photoblog.com/"]Photoblog[/URL] [URL="https://www.minds.com/"]Minds[/URL] [URL="https://kinja.com/"]Kinja[/URL] [URL="https://imgbb.com/"]Imgbb[/URL] [URL="http://www.dropbox.com"]Dropbox[/URL] (with caveats) Here is an image of my truck loaded from Screencast under its "free" account: [ATTACH=full]275631[/ATTACH] Here is the same image loaded from my Dropbox account: [ATTACH=full]275632[/ATTACH] Note: To make Dropbox images display as actual images you have to modify your copied Dropbox link from (in my case): [url]https://www.dropbox.com/s/r67i2i8zdx1y2b4/IMG_2051.JPG?dl=0[/url] to: [url]https://dl.dropboxusercontent.com/s/r67i2i8zdx1y2b4/IMG_2051.JPG?raw=1[/url] In other words, the "www.dropbox.com" portion of your link will need to be changed to "dl.dropboxusercontent.com". I also replaced the "?dl=0" to "?raw=1" at the end of the link. (Please, don't use the quotation marks.) Thankfully, the Forums here autosize oversized images. If you must use Photobucket and have a spare $400 laying around to spend for the privilege of linking to your images, more power to you! For the rest of you, there are a number of ways to circumvent Photobucket (listed & linked above) that may get you started down the road to a more cost affordable solution. The list isn't exhaustive by any means and your milage may vary. Be sure and test before committing to a particular image hosting service to ensure it is compatible with this and the other forums you use. [/QUOTE]
